Pine Floor Refinishing in Olathe, KS
Pine floor refinishing services involve restoring and renewing hardwood floors to improve their appearance and durability. This process typically includes sanding away old finishes, scratches, and stains, followed by applying a fresh coat of stain or sealant. Property owners often seek this service for various projects such as updating worn-out flooring, preparing a home for sale, or simply enhancing the aesthetic appeal of a living space. Hom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work, the types of finishes available, and how the refinishing process can extend the life of their floors before requesting service.
Before requesting pine floor refinishing, property owners should consider the current condition of their flooring, including any deep scratches, water damage, or uneven surfaces that might require additional repairs. It’s also helpful to determine the desired look-whether a natural wood finish or a specific stain color-and to inquire about the types of sealants used for protection. Understanding the potential impact of the process on daily activities and the overall timeline can help in planning the project effectively.

Pine Floor Refinishing Questions
What types of wood floors can be refinished? Most hardwood floors, including oak, maple, and hickory, can be refinished to restore their appearance and durability.
Is dust created during the refinishing process? Yes, sanding generates dust, but modern equipment helps minimize airborne particles and cleanup is typically straightforward.
Can existing stains or finishes be changed during refinishing? Yes, the process allows for removing old finishes and applying new stains or sealants for a fresh look.
What is the best way to prepare a room for refinishing? Clearing furniture and rugs from the area helps ensure a smooth process and a high-quality finish.
